The area
Pretty Reberty Village, situated at 2000m, is halfway between Val Thorens and Saint Martin de Belleville in Les Trois Vallees ski domain (The Three Valleys). Le Bettex (name of the hamlet) is a charming Savoyard village located close to Saint Martin de Belleville. The village is a well-designed new development built along traditional lines and to high standards. At the top of the village you will find La Ferme, an excellent bar/restaurant with a warm welcome and great atmosphere. A useful, small supermarket is located within 100 yards.
Les Menuires is a good gateway into famous Les Trois Vallées, which has some of the best Alpine skiing. One of the most extensively linked ski areas in the world, The Three Valleys has a massive 600km of pistes. There is a great choice of terrain, making it suitable for all levels of skiers and boarders. Located high within the Three Valleys, Les Menuires usually has some of the best snow conditions to be found in France. Access to the well-known resorts of Meribel and Courchevel is easy, and there are many restaurants and bars on the slopes in all three valleys.

Les Arcs
With the introduction of the brand new connection between Les Arcs and La Plagne, Les Arcs has become one of the most talked about ski resorts in the world.
Les Arcs 2000 is located just below the Aiguille Rouge with spectacular views of the Mont Blanc, where the first and best snow falls, it is in the heart of the Les Arcs ski domain, one of the most extensive and varied ski areas of the world. The Grand Domaine of Les Arcs-La Plagne has a new name - Paradiski - and has now become one of the largest ski areas in the world, as Les Arcs and La Plagne are now linked by the longest cable car of its type ever built. The cabins are large enough for 200 people and cross the Ponthurin Vally in just 4 minutes.
Found in the Tarentaise, Les Arcs sits directly above the town of Bourg St Maurice. Although 15km by road the resort can also be reached by funicular from Bourg St Maurice. It was created by the visionary Robert Blanc in 1968, who was responsible for the revolutionary teaching method 'Ski Evolutif'. This system - where you get longer skis as you improve - is still used there today.
Skiing
One of the most extensive and varied ski domains in the world - great for all types of skiers from beginners to advanced, Les Arcs now linked to La Plagne, the new Paradiski area, offers 240 miles of pistes, including the Aiguille Rouge glacier above Arc 2000 (15 yards from the ilfts taking you there) and the Bellecote glacier in La Plagne, guaranteeing snow. Les Arc is a skier and snowboarder's heaven.
For beginners, Les Arcs is well-equipped with gentle beginner's slopes - a boon for the inexperienced.
For intermediates, Les Arcs offers fantastic tree-lined descents into Peisey Nancroix and Vallandry and a multitude of interlinked blue and red runs. We recommend you try some high altitude skiing on the Aiguille Rouge and Bellecote glaciers.
For the advanced, ski the breathtaking 4 mile black run Aiguille Rouge right the way down into Villaroger (Europe's biggest vertical drop of 2000m), pound the moguls of Dou de l'Homme or take the new 200 seater lift over to La Plagne and return off-piste through the imposing Nancroix forest.
For boarders, it has become the home of a number of snowboard pros due to superb board park and half-pipe. There are so many natural hits to play on in the Clocheret area that there is no danger of running out of things to do. There is also abundant terrain for beginners to progress on all week.
In summary in Les Arcs, there are 200km of pistes, 20 hectares of snow making, the longest run Aiguille Rouge piste is 7km is length and 2100m in vertical descent, there is 30km of cross-country skiing, 16 mountain restaurants and 60 lifts (1 cablecar, 30 chairlifts (6 high speed), 24 draglifts, 1 funicular and, 4 gondolas). There is also guaranteed snow (artificial snow) back to the resort all season long.

Buying a home overseas through leaseback can make it easy to find a dream home that's tax efficient and generates guaranteed rental income, says Savills' Susan Wright.
Life doesn't get much better than walking up to a vista of snow-covered Alps, stepping out of the door, strapping on your skies and taking off for a day on the slopes. It's why thousands of people return to the Alps every year and why they consider buying a property to rent out and use themselves. But if the thought of managing a rental property (with bookings, voids, cancellations and domestic services to deal with) puts you off then perhaps you should consider leaseback.
Through leaseback the buyer owns the freehold but leases the property back to the developer in return for a guaranteed yearly rental income. Financial analyst Michael Halliday opted for leaseback when he bought a ski in/ski out apartment in Les Arcs in the French Alps four years ago. He and his wife spend one or two weeks there each year, while lucky friends and family make the most of it during a further weeks. "We've been absolutely thrilled with it," says Halliday. "It's gone up in value hugely but the most important thing is it’s beautifully looked after and totally hassle-free."
It costs Michael nothing to furnish or keep his apartment because the leaseback company meets those costs and the rental income he receives covers most of the mortgage. "The term leaseback many be misleading or off-putting for some, but it's really just a fixed rental system," he says. "You could do just as well financially renting a property out yourself but it would be a lot more hassle."

Les Deux Alpes, the resort
Virtually guaranteed snowcover from October to May, the resort is a snowboarding mecca, hosting the highest snowboarding championship in the world. The village itself has a reputation for lively nightlife and the children’s fun area offers activities including a toboggan run and snowscooter track.
Apres-ski
Les Deux Alpes: skating rink, swimming-pool, fitness centre, aquagym, driving on ice circuit, museums, cinema, ice cave, bowling, bars and discos.
Les Deux Alpes ski domain Click for map
Since 1946 and the first ski lift, Les 2 Alpes has always been innovating and developing its slopes, guided by the evolution of skiing.
An ever-wider range of pistes has become a playground for young and old. In addition to traditional maintenance and improvement work on the slopes, replacement of lifts, and the development of artificial snow production, the resort has made room to the new wave of snow sports with the creation of the SLIDE zone. This innovative concept allows each and everyone to safely discover all of today’s new skiing activities. Ledges, waterfalls, canyons, gullies, etc., including a 900 m-long boardercross and new facilities for kids.
Marked pistes = 500 ha
Off-piste = 1400 ha
Artificial snow = 47 ha with 191 snow guns
Cross-country skiing = 25 km (Molière des Peyrons trail and Venosc)
102 pistes (13 black, 17 red, 45 blue, 27green)
51 ski lifts including 1 elevator, 1 funicular, 3 cabin lifts, 3 gondola lifts, 23 chair lifts, 19 ski tows, and 1 beginner’s tow.
The snowpark covers 20 ha dedicated to freestyle with unique and exclusive ramps (halfpipe, gaps, hips, handrails, big air, and learning ramps).
The boardercross run includes whoops, banked curves, and jumps, with a difference in altitude of 185 m and over 1,000 m of action
The Gully: 150 m long, 80% gradient
The Canyons: 2,500 m long
The Waterfalls: 550 m long with 10 waterfalls
The Ledge: 16 m longAccess
Artificial snow
Every year the resort of 2 Alpes continues to improve its artificial snow coverage. This year the emphasis has been placed on the Vallée Blanche/Pied Moutet sector where all of the pistes served by the Super Venosc, Pied Moutet, Vallée Blanche and the new Cote chair-lifts will benefit from artificial snow.
This will therefore ensure decent skiing on the entire western sector of the ski area and a permanent east/west link throughout the winter.
Artificial snow coverage has also been improved on all of the lower slopes including the beginner pistes, kindergarten, free lifts and the Côte Brune slalom run.

La Plagne 1800
Now part of the Paradiski ski domain, La Plagne is at the hub of an immense ski circuit, having linked its already extensive terrain to the neighbouring resort of Les Arcs providing skiers access to 425km of piste, 2 glaciers and two two-tiered cable cars with a capacity of 200. In addition to the variety of slopes, La Plagne also has an excellent snow record and varied evening entertainment.
Plagne 1800 has gentle forest surroundings and a village made up of traditional chalet style buildings with direct access to the pistes. Just 200m from our accommodation is the ski school meeting point and access to the Crête Côte 1800 ski lift. From the top of this lift, skiers can ascend further to Aime la Plagne at 2100m or enjoy the wonderful runs down through the woods to the village of Plagne Montalbert.
Freestylers love La Plagne - a permanent half-pipe, a selection of boarder parks and designated areas with bumps and jumps - a real boarder's paradise!
Wherever you are in La Plagne, the villages are 'ski-in' and 'ski-out' - the interlinked lift system is unrivalled and even at night lifts are operated to transport you to your evening entertainment.
